His collegiate career for the University of Florida was marked by quite a few NCAA titles and record-breaking performances. Through his time as being a Gator, Dressel formulated into Probably the most dominant collegiate swimmers in heritage, setting the stage for his Intercontinental achievement.
In the course of the Rio 2016 Olympic Game titles, Dressel secured gold medals in both the 4x100m freestyle relay and 4x100m medley relay. Inside the Tokyo 2020 Olympic Online games, Dressel claimed 5 gold medals: in the person 100m freestyle, 100m butterfly, and 50m freestyle situations, as well as the 4x100m freestyle relay and 4x100m medley relay.
